本發明涉及一種硬碟固定機構及具有該硬碟固定機構之電子裝置。 The present invention relates to a hard disk fixing mechanism and an electronic device having the same.
硬碟係電腦、具有硬碟之電視機、遊戲機等電子裝置之資料存儲設備之一,其固定於電子裝置之框架上。硬碟於工作時會產生振動,如果固定不好就可能損壞硬碟,導致硬碟內存儲之資訊丟失。為了較好地固定硬碟,一般採用硬碟固定機構將硬碟固定於電子裝置的框架上。 One of the data storage devices of a hard disk computer, an electronic device having a hard disk, a game machine, and the like, which is fixed on the frame of the electronic device. The hard disk generates vibration when it is working. If it is not fixed properly, it may damage the hard disk, resulting in loss of information stored in the hard disk. In order to fix the hard disk better, the hard disk fixing mechanism is generally used to fix the hard disk to the frame of the electronic device.
一種硬碟固定機構,其用於將硬碟固定於電子裝置框架上。該框架包括一底面及一側面。該硬碟固定機構包括固定支架、硬碟盒及螺絲。固定支架直立於框架之底面且與框架之側面相距有一定間距。該硬碟固定於硬碟盒中。該硬碟盒之側面延伸有一突出之固定部。螺絲將硬碟盒之固定部鎖固於固定支架上,從而硬碟及固定支架被固定於該框架上。 A hard disk fixing mechanism for fixing a hard disk to an electronic device frame. The frame includes a bottom surface and a side surface. The hard disk fixing mechanism includes a fixing bracket, a hard disk case, and a screw. The fixing bracket is erected on the bottom surface of the frame and spaced apart from the side of the frame. The hard disk is fixed in a hard disk case. A protruding fixing portion is extended on a side of the hard disk case. The screw locks the fixing portion of the hard disk case to the fixing bracket, so that the hard disk and the fixing bracket are fixed to the frame.
然,隨著一些電腦、具有硬碟之電視機、遊戲機等電子裝置越來越趨向小型化,於狹小之電子裝置框架內利用螺絲刀組裝和拆卸硬碟操作不方便,且造成整個拆卸過程繁瑣。 However, with the increasing miniaturization of electronic devices such as computers, hard disk televisions, and game consoles, it is inconvenient to assemble and disassemble hard disks using a screwdriver in a narrow electronic device frame, and the entire disassembly process is cumbersome. .
鑒於上述內容,有必要提供一種拆卸方便之硬碟固定機構,同時,還有必要提供一種具有上述硬碟固定機構之電子裝置。 In view of the above, it is necessary to provide a hard disk fixing mechanism which is easy to disassemble, and at the same time, it is also necessary to provide an electronic device having the above-described hard disk fixing mechanism.
一種硬碟固定機構,其用於將硬碟固定於電子裝置之框架上,硬碟固定機構包括鎖固件、限位件及設於電子裝置框架上之卡持部,鎖固件將限位件固定於硬碟上,限位件上設有彈性限位部,借助彈性限位部之彈性形變與恢復,彈性限位部可相對卡持部滑動或與卡持部相卡持,以使鎖固件可分離地卡固於卡持部,該卡持部為基本垂直設於該框架上之固定塊,該固定塊上開設有卡合槽及與該卡合槽連通之開口,該鎖固件從該開口進入與退出該卡合槽中。 A hard disk fixing mechanism for fixing a hard disk to a frame of an electronic device, wherein the hard disk fixing mechanism comprises a locking member, a limiting member and a holding portion disposed on the frame of the electronic device, and the locking device fixes the limiting member On the hard disk, the limiting member is provided with an elastic limiting portion, and the elastic limiting portion is slidable relative to the clamping portion or is engaged with the locking portion by the elastic deformation and recovery of the elastic limiting portion, so that the locking member Separably fastened to the holding portion, the holding portion is a fixing block substantially perpendicularly disposed on the frame, and the fixing block is provided with an engaging groove and an opening communicating with the engaging groove, the locking member is The opening enters and exits the engagement slot.
一種電子裝置,其包括框架、硬碟及將硬碟固定於框架上之硬碟固定機構,硬碟固定機構包括鎖固件、限位件及設於框架上之卡持部,鎖固件將限位件固定於硬碟上,限位件設有彈性限位部,借助彈性限位部之彈性形變與恢復,彈性限位部可相對卡持部滑動或與卡持部相卡持,以使鎖固件可分離地卡固於卡持部,該卡持部為基本垂直設於該框架上之固定塊,該固定塊上開設有卡合槽及與該卡合槽連通之開口,該鎖固件從該開口進入與退出該卡合槽中。 An electronic device includes a frame, a hard disk, and a hard disk fixing mechanism for fixing the hard disk to the frame. The hard disk fixing mechanism includes a locking member, a limiting member and a holding portion disposed on the frame, and the locking member is limited The elastic fixing portion is fixed on the hard disk, and the elastic limiting portion is elastically deformed and restored by the elastic limiting portion, and the elastic limiting portion can slide relative to the clamping portion or be engaged with the clamping portion to make the lock The fixing member is detachably fastened to the holding portion, and the holding portion is a fixing block substantially perpendicularly disposed on the frame, and the fixing block is provided with an engaging groove and an opening communicating with the engaging groove, the locking member is The opening enters and exits the engagement slot.
上述硬碟固定機構僅需藉由鎖固件與卡持部相卡持,限位件之彈性限位部定位鎖固件,就可將硬碟固定於框架上;並且,藉由控制限位件之彈性限位部之彈性形變之發生及恢復,可對硬碟進行安裝及拆卸,此過程無需其他額外之工具。故,硬碟固定機構結 構簡單且拆卸方便。 The hard disk fixing mechanism only needs to be locked by the locking portion by the locking member, and the elastic limiting portion of the limiting member positions the locking device to fix the hard disk to the frame; and, by controlling the limiting member The occurrence and recovery of the elastic deformation of the elastic limiter allows the hard disk to be mounted and removed without any additional tools. Therefore, the hard disk fixing mechanism knot The structure is simple and easy to disassemble.

下面將結合附圖及具體實施方式對本發明之硬碟固定機構及具有該硬碟固定機構之電子裝置作進一步詳細說明。 The hard disk fixing mechanism of the present invention and the electronic device having the hard disk fixing mechanism will be further described in detail below with reference to the accompanying drawings and specific embodiments.
本發明涉及之電子裝置可為電腦、具有硬碟之電視機、遊戲機等,本實施方式以主機與顯示器一體化之桌面電腦為例進行說明。 The electronic device according to the present invention can be a computer, a television with a hard disk, a game machine, etc. The present embodiment is described by taking a desktop computer integrated with a host and a display as an example.
請參閱圖1及圖2,本發明實施方式之電子裝置100包括框架10、硬碟20及硬碟固定機構30。硬碟固定機構30將硬碟20固定於框架10上。硬碟20具有二相對側面22。該二相對側面22上分別開設有螺孔221。 Referring to FIG. 1 and FIG. 2 , the electronic device 100 of the embodiment of the present invention includes a frame 10 , a hard disk 20 , and a hard disk fixing mechanism 30 . The hard disk fixing mechanism 30 fixes the hard disk 20 to the frame 10. The hard disk 20 has two opposing sides 22. Screw holes 221 are defined in the two opposite side faces 22, respectively.
硬碟固定機構30包括限位件32、設於框架10上之卡持部34及鎖固件36。鎖固件36將限位件32固定於硬碟20上,且其可與卡持部34相卡合。 The hard disk fixing mechanism 30 includes a limiting member 32, a holding portion 34 provided on the frame 10, and a locking member 36. The lock member 36 fixes the stopper 32 to the hard disk 20 and is engageable with the catch portion 34.
限位件32為一近似U型結構,其包括一基板324以及從該基板324二相對側垂直向外延伸之二相對側壁322。每一側壁322上設有通孔321及彈性限位部323。通孔321以供鎖固件36穿設。彈性限位 部323發生彈性形變後可恢復,其可定位鎖固件36,以使鎖固件36與卡持部34卡合後而定位。具體於本實施方式中,彈性限位部323為從側壁322上沿朝向基板324之方向延伸之彈片,該彈片於外力作用下可改變與側壁322之間之距離。基板324上開設有散熱網孔325,以便於硬碟20散熱。 The limiting member 32 is an approximately U-shaped structure including a substrate 324 and two opposite sidewalls 322 extending perpendicularly outward from opposite sides of the substrate 324. Each of the side walls 322 is provided with a through hole 321 and an elastic limiting portion 323. The through hole 321 is provided for the fastener 36 to pass through. Flexible limit The portion 323 is resiliently deformable and recoverable, and the locking member 36 can be positioned to position the locking member 36 after the locking portion 36 is engaged with the retaining portion 34. Specifically, in the embodiment, the elastic limiting portion 323 is a spring piece extending from the side wall 322 in a direction toward the substrate 324, and the elastic piece can change the distance from the side wall 322 by an external force. A heat dissipation mesh 325 is defined in the substrate 324 to facilitate heat dissipation of the hard disk 20.
卡持部34為從框架10上垂直延伸之固定塊,其上開設有“L”型卡合槽342。卡持部34上還開設有與卡合槽342連通之開口(未標示),鎖固件36從該開口進入與退出卡合槽342。 The holding portion 34 is a fixing block extending perpendicularly from the frame 10, and an "L" type engaging groove 342 is opened thereon. An opening (not shown) communicating with the engaging groove 342 is also formed in the holding portion 34, and the locking member 36 enters and exits the engaging groove 342 from the opening.
請參閱圖3,鎖固件36為內六角螺絲,其包括螺紋部362及與螺紋部362連接之頭部364。頭部364與螺紋部362相連之一端上設有抵擋部365,其另一端之端面366上開設有六角形螺孔367。 Referring to FIG. 3, the fastener 36 is a hexagon socket screw that includes a threaded portion 362 and a head portion 364 that is coupled to the threaded portion 362. One end of the head 364 connected to the threaded portion 362 is provided with a resisting portion 365, and the end surface 366 of the other end is provided with a hexagonal screw hole 367.
請一併參閱圖4,將硬碟20固定於框架10上時,首先,將鎖固件36穿設限位件32之通孔321後,與硬碟20之螺孔221螺合,從而將限位件32固定於硬碟20上。然後,將硬碟20及限位件32放置於框架10上,使鎖固件36之頭部364對應於卡持部34之開口,下壓限位件32,使限位件32之彈性限位部323與卡持部34相抵持而發生彈性形變,從而使得鎖固件36之頭部364容置於卡持部34之卡合槽342中。最後,將鎖固件36之頭部364沿著卡持部34之卡合槽342之延伸方向滑動,使彈性限位部323恢復形變而定位將鎖固件36之頭部364定位於卡持部34之卡合槽342中,最終將硬碟20牢固地固定於框架10上。 Referring to FIG. 4, when the hard disk 20 is fixed to the frame 10, first, the locking member 36 is inserted into the through hole 321 of the limiting member 32, and then screwed into the screw hole 221 of the hard disk 20, thereby limiting the limit. The bit member 32 is fixed to the hard disk 20. Then, the hard disk 20 and the limiting member 32 are placed on the frame 10, so that the head 364 of the locking member 36 corresponds to the opening of the holding portion 34, and the limiting member 32 is pressed down to make the elastic limit of the limiting member 32. The portion 323 is elastically deformed by the holding portion 34 so that the head portion 364 of the locking member 36 is received in the engaging groove 342 of the holding portion 34. Finally, the head 364 of the locking member 36 is slid along the extending direction of the engaging groove 342 of the holding portion 34, so that the elastic limiting portion 323 is restored and positioned to position the head 364 of the locking member 36 at the holding portion 34. In the engagement groove 342, the hard disk 20 is finally firmly fixed to the frame 10.
從框架10上拆卸硬碟20時,首先,按壓限位件32之彈性限位部 323使其發生彈性形變,並將鎖固件36之頭部364沿卡持部34之卡合槽342之延伸方向滑動,使限位件32之彈性限位部323與卡持部34相抵持而發生彈性形變。然後,繼續將鎖固件36之頭部364沿卡持部34之卡合槽342之延伸方向滑動,直至滑動至卡持部34之卡合槽342之拐角處。最後,直接將硬碟20及限位件32沿遠離框架10之方向拔出。 When the hard disk 20 is detached from the frame 10, first, the elastic limit portion of the limiting member 32 is pressed. The 323 is elastically deformed, and the head 364 of the locking member 36 is slid along the extending direction of the engaging groove 342 of the latching portion 34, so that the elastic limiting portion 323 of the limiting member 32 abuts the latching portion 34. Elastic deformation occurs. Then, the head 364 of the fastener 36 is continued to slide in the extending direction of the engaging groove 342 of the catching portion 34 until it slides to the corner of the engaging groove 342 of the engaging portion 34. Finally, the hard disk 20 and the limiting member 32 are directly pulled out in the direction away from the frame 10.
上述硬碟固定機構30僅需通過鎖固件36之頭部364與卡持部34相卡持,限位件32之彈性限位部323與卡持部34相抵持,即可將硬碟20固定於框架10上;並且,藉由控制限位件32之彈性限位部323之彈性形變之發生及恢復,可對硬碟20進行安裝及拆卸,此過程無需其他額外之工具。故,硬碟固定機構30結構簡單且拆卸方便。另,硬碟固定機構30體積較小,以便於電子裝置100輕小化。 The hard disk fixing mechanism 30 only needs to be engaged with the latching portion 34 through the head 364 of the locking member 36, and the elastic limiting portion 323 of the limiting member 32 is abutted against the latching portion 34, so that the hard disk 20 can be fixed. On the frame 10; and by the occurrence and recovery of the elastic deformation of the elastic limiting portion 323 of the control member 32, the hard disk 20 can be mounted and removed without any additional tools. Therefore, the hard disk fixing mechanism 30 has a simple structure and is easy to disassemble. In addition, the hard disk fixing mechanism 30 is small in size to facilitate the miniaturization of the electronic device 100.
可以理解,鎖固件36不限於內六角螺絲,僅需該鎖固件36可將限位件32固定於硬碟20上且可與卡持部34相卡持即可,例如,鎖固件36可為螺釘、螺栓等。限位件32不限於包括基體324及二相對側壁322,僅需該限位件32可固定於硬碟20上即可,例如,該限位件32為兩塊固定片,固定片上設有彈性限位部323。並且,彈性限位部323不限於均設於每一側壁322上,僅需至少其中一側壁設有彈性限位部323即可。卡持部34不限於為開設有卡合槽342之固定塊,僅需其可與鎖固件36相卡持且可與限位件32之彈性限位部323相抵持即可,例如,卡持部34可為“L”型卡鉤。 It can be understood that the locking member 36 is not limited to the hexagon socket screw. The locking member 36 only needs to fix the limiting member 32 to the hard disk 20 and can be engaged with the holding portion 34. For example, the locking member 36 can be Screws, bolts, etc. The limiting member 32 is not limited to include the base 324 and the opposite side walls 322. The limiting member 32 can be fixed to the hard disk 20. For example, the limiting member 32 is two fixing pieces, and the fixing piece is provided with elasticity. The limiting unit 323. Moreover, the elastic limiting portion 323 is not limited to being disposed on each of the side walls 322, and only one of the side walls is required to be provided with the elastic limiting portion 323. The holding portion 34 is not limited to the fixed block in which the engaging groove 342 is opened, and only needs to be engaged with the locking member 36 and can be resisted by the elastic limiting portion 323 of the limiting member 32, for example, the holding Portion 34 can be an "L" type hook.
